    @Override
    public JobExecutionImpl createJobExecution(final JobInstanceImpl jobInstance, final Properties jobParameters) {
        final JobExecutionImpl jobExecution = new JobExecutionImpl(jobInstance, jobParameters);
        insertJobExecution(jobExecution);
        final JobExecution jobExecutionExisting = jobExecutions.putIfAbsent(jobExecution.getExecutionId(), jobExecution);
        if (jobExecutionExisting != null) {
            throw BatchMessages.MESSAGES.jobExecutionAlreadyExists(jobExecutionExisting.getExecutionId());
        }
        jobInstance.addJobExecution(jobExecution);
        return jobExecution;
    }
